The Freberg Brothers win the BU Prize – a strong recognition of innovation in agriculture

The Freberg Brothers winning the BU Award is a clear confirmation of many years of focused work in agriculture and business development. The award is presented by Innovation Norway on behalf of the Ministry of Agriculture and Food, and has been presented since 1997.

The BU award goes to actors who can demonstrate particularly successful industrial and business development in agriculture, and who at the same time serve as an inspiration to others. The Freberg brothers meet these criteria through their long-term work, clear will to innovate and sustainable operations.

What is the BU Award, and why is it important?

The BU Award, also known as the Business Development Award in Agriculture, is one of the most recognized awards within the Norwegian agricultural industry. The purpose of the award is to:

  • Highlight good examples of business development in agriculture
  • Inspiring other farmers and agricultural businesses
  • Make innovation and value creation visible throughout the country

County-specific awards are given out and 3 finalists will compete for the Business Development Award in Agriculture.

Clear criteria: Inspiring, innovative and sustainable

To win the BU award, the company must meet three key criteria:

1. Inspiring

The winner will be a role model for others in the industry, both through results and through the way the business is run.

2. Innovative

Innovation is central. It can be new products, new forms of operation or smart combinations of tradition and development.

3. Sustainable

Economic, environmental and social sustainability are all emphasized. Long-term value creation is crucial.

The Freberg brothers have shown that it is possible to combine these three elements in a way that provides both profitability and social value.
